No, I don't mean those birds, so no curry and a babycham answers please....[:)] I have rigged up a table at the window and so far have tried Sunflower seeds, bread crumbs, chopped mixed dried fruit, so far only a family of Great Tits has been brave enough or tempted and they only take the sunflower seeds. I know that I have others arouns including a couple of Redstarts, so what do I need to offer them to bring them to my table? OK go on then, daft answers too!

Redstarts come to us each winter and strip any remaining apples from our trees, and munch all the windfalls; they rarely touch anything else from the feeders, or the garden.

We buy sunflower seed hearts, I think they're called - not whole ones with seed covers. Nuthatches, robins etc are very keen on them, besides the more usual great, blue and long-tailed tits.
